uniapp を開発するとき、プログラマーは理解できないエラーに遭遇することがよくあります。これらのエラーにより、アプリケーションがクラッシュしたり、正しく機能しなくなったりして、開発プロセスに不要なトラブルが発生する可能性があります。 uniapp エラーが発生する具体的な状況をより深く理解していただくために、この記事では一般的な uniapp エラー ログを紹介し、これらのエラーのトラブルシューティングと処理方法について説明します。
JS 例外は通常、コード構文エラーまたは実行時例外によって発生します。アプリケーションが未定義または存在しない変数名、オブジェクト プロパティ、または関数メソッドにアクセスしようとすると、例外がスローされます。さらに深刻な状況は、汎用 JS コードの記述が不十分なためにアプリケーション全体がクラッシュする場合です。
トラブルシューティング方法:
Chrome の開発者ツールの [コンソール] タブを使用して、最近の JS 例外を表示できます。このツールを使用して、異常の特定の種類と発生場所を特定します。
対処方法:
JS 例外は通常、構文エラーとコード ロジックの問題によって発生します。これらの例外を処理するときは、まず例外が発生したコードの場所を特定し、コードの構文とロジックに問題がないかどうかを確認する必要があります。これらの例外は多くの場合、直接見つけるのが難しいため、コンソール出力を使用して詳細なデバッグ情報を取得し、問題を正確に特定できることに注意してください。
uniapp フレームワークにおける Vue 例外は主に、不正な命令、未定義のコンポーネント、非 Vue 要素などが原因で発生します。これらの例外はコンパイル時またはレンダリング時のエラーによって引き起こされることが多く、アプリケーションのクラッシュやハングを引き起こす可能性があります。
トラブルシューティング方法:
uniapp 開発ツールの「コンソール」を開いて、Vue 例外の詳細情報を取得できます。同様に、エラー メッセージは Chrome デベロッパー ツールのコンソール タブで確認できます。
処理方法:
Vue 例外は通常、テンプレート構文、コンポーネント定義、および Vue レンダリング エンジンによって発生します。これらの例外を処理するときは、コード ロジックとテンプレート構文を最適化するか、コンポーネントが正しく定義されているかどうかを確認することで問題を解決できます。
HTTP エラーは、アプリケーションとリモート サーバー間の通信エラーが原因で非常によく発生します。これらのエラーは、サーバーに接続できないこと、タイムアウト、またはデータを取得できないことが原因である可能性があります。
トラブルシューティング方法:
開発ツールの「ネットワーク」タブを使用して、リモート サーバーとの通信データを表示できます。このタブには、HTTP エラーが発生した場合の情報が表示されます。
対処方法:
HTTP エラーは、リモート サーバーと対話するプログラム ロジックによって発生することがよくあります。この問題は、サーバーの通信コードとロジックを最適化するか、ネットワークとサーバーを調整することで解決できます。
まとめ:
uniapp のエラー ログは開発プロセスで避けられない問題の 1 つですが、プログラマにとってエラー ログの原因と解決策を理解することは、さまざまな問題に対処するのに役立ちます。開発過程で遭遇したもの。最も重要なことは、コードのロジックがより明確になり、プログラムがより安定するように、エラー ログを処理する際に常に忍耐と冷静さを保つことです。
以上が一般的な uniapp エラー ログはありますか?トラブルシューティングと治療方法の簡単な分析の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。